Carboxy-terminal truncation of the RhoGEF64C sequences.
Expression of Gef64CΔC.Scer\UAS under the control of Scer\GAL4elav.PLu does not result in a gain of function defective axon guidance phenotype.
RhoGEF64CΔC.UAS, Scer\GAL4ems.HRE is a non-suppressor of posterior spiracle primordium phenotype of Rho1N19.UAS, Scer\GAL4ems.HRE
Co-expression of Gef64CΔC.Scer\UAS does not rescue the invagination defects seen in the posterior spiracles of embryos expressing Rho1N19.Scer\UAS under the control of Scer\GAL4ems.HRE.
